Johns Hopkins University | AS.100.234

The Making of the Muslim Middle East, 600-1100 A.D.

A survey of the major historical transformations of the region we now call the 'Middle East' (from late antiquity through the 11th century) in relation to the formation and development of Islam and various Muslim empires. Cross-listed with Near Eastern Studies and the Program in Islamic Studies.
